Furthermore, the gamification of flirting can blur the boundaries between virtual and real‑world consent. Features such as text messaging, emojis, and digital flirtation “introduce new complexities to consent negotiation, while the persistence of digital records challenges individuals’ ability to retract consent”. In other words, once a flirtatious interaction is recorded in a game or app, it may be difficult to undo or escape.
